pcm脉冲编码程序.doc

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
脉冲编码调制(PCM)实现 pcm原理框图 1. 抽样抽样必须遵循奈奎斯特抽样定理,离散信号才可以完全代替连续信号。 低通连续信号抽样定理内容:一个频带限制在 内的连续信号 ,图 1 带通连续信号的抽样定理: 一个频带限制在(,)赫内的带通型时间连续信号,其带宽为,当以(是小于的最大整数)的抽样频率对进行抽样,则将被所得到的抽样值完全确定。2. 量化 量化误差:量化后的信号和抽样信号的差值。量化误差在接收端表现为噪声,称为量化噪声。量化级数越多误差越小,相应的二进制码位数越多,要求传输速率越高,频带越宽。为使量化噪声尽可能小而所需码位数又不太多,通常采用非均匀量化的方法进行量化。非均匀量化根据幅度的不同区间来确定量化间隔,幅度小的区间量化间隔取得小,幅度大的区间量化间隔取得大。均匀量化:ADC输入动态范围被均匀地划分为2^n份。非均匀量化的实现方法有两种:一种是北美和日本采用的μ律压扩,一种是欧洲和我国采用的A律压扩。在PCM-30/32通信设备中,采用A律13折线的分段方法,具体是:Y轴均匀分为8段,每段均匀分为16份,每份表示一个量化级,则Y轴一共有16×8=128个量化级。;X轴采用非均匀划分来实现非均匀量化的目的,划分规律是每次按二分之一来进行分段。? 编码就是将量化后的信号编码形成一个二进制码组输出。 ITU建议采用折叠二进码FBC(Folded Binary Code)与其它码相比,在小电平时,抗误码性能好。若采用普通二进码,信号为均匀分布,可计算得到有误码时的量化信噪比。 其中 详细设计步骤 本次课程设计分为两个部分:(1)采样;(2)量化和编码(量化和编码合在一起完成的)。其中采样又分为低通和带通连续信号采样两种情形,对采样定理进行验证。 3.1采样 3.1.1低通采样 (1)首先应该确定被采样的连续信号。 (2)根据输入的连续信号,计算满足低通抽样定理的采样频率。 (3)由于是对采样定理进行验证就要设计满足采样定理的频率和不满足条件的进行对比。 (4)编写程序,画出满足采样定理和不满足的时、频图形。 3.1.2带通采样 带通的设计和低通的很类似,过程和设计思路几乎一样。只不过设计过程中满足的条件有所改变,而且被采样的连续信号也不一样。因此编写的高通程序和低通的很相似,只有小部分地方需要修改。 3.2量化和编码 由于设计要求的编码内容就是将13折线的A律近似法及国际标准PCM对数A律量化编码。实现64级电平的均匀量化13折线的A律近似法及国际标准PCM对数A律量化编码。z = 0 0.9029 0.9908 0.9908 0.9029 0.0000 -0.9029 -0.9908 -0.9908 -0.9029 -0.0000 非均匀量化十三折线输出序列为: z = 0 0.9045 1.0000 1.0000 0.9045 0.0000 -0.9045 -1.0000 -1.0000 -0.9045 -0.0000 十三折线的编码输出: f = 1 0 0 0 0 0 0 0 1 1 1 0 1 0 1 1 1 1 1 1 0 1 0 0 1 0 0 1 0 0 1 0 0 1 1 0 0 0 0 0 0 1 1 1 1 0 1 0 0 0 1 0 0 0 1 1 1 1 0 1 0 1 0 0 1 1 1 1 1 1 1 0 1 0 1 1 0 1 0 0 0 1 0 0 0 1 0 1 图 体会 在此次设计中,我们将课本知识与实际应用联系起来,按照书本上的知识和老师讲授的方法,首先分析本次课程设计的任务和要求,然后按照分析的结果进行实际的编程操作,检测和校正,再进一步完善程序。在调试程序的过程中遇到很多的问题,大多数都

文档评论(0)

ddf55855 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档